Transaction 66bc3e7322ab8442f23056b7fb344267840f5eaf8c86a1232ff84230dc470495

1 Input
2 Outputs
  • 66bc3e7322ab8442f23056b7fb344267840f5eaf8c86a1232ff84230dc470495:0
  • value  601292
    address  bc1q567rzkxxq0w8tvtzufhf6gqxnlfk8km48957nf
  • 66bc3e7322ab8442f23056b7fb344267840f5eaf8c86a1232ff84230dc470495:1
  • value  20830000
    address  1DTjKsFpgQQ6c7bBqkJa4VXEpuQ3zx3MEi